In that house lives the Keeper of the Books
Who fills his shelves for the sake of looks

Within lie tomes of ancient history
And a great deal on crime and mystery

In all his years he's not read one
To read would mean his mind undone

Texts on science and philosophy
Books of romance and geography

All lay quiet, gathering dust
Abandoned like metal left to rust

What good in all the world are books
If only ever kept for looks?
